How to fill out electric safety on construction

To fill out electric safety on construction, follow these steps:
01
Identify potential electrical hazards: Assess the construction site for any existing or potential electrical hazards such as exposed wires, damaged cables, or improper grounding.
02
Develop a comprehensive safety plan: Create a detailed electric safety plan that includes all the necessary precautions and procedures to ensure the safety of workers and others at the construction site.
03
Conduct regular inspections: Regularly inspect the construction site to identify any new electrical hazards that may have arisen during the construction process. Address and rectify these hazards promptly.
04
Provide proper training: Ensure that all personnel involved in the construction project receive adequate training on electrical safety protocols. This training should cover topics such as proper use of electrical equipment, understanding warning signs, and emergency response procedures.
05
Use appropriate personal protective equipment (PPE): Encourage workers to wear protective gear such as insulated gloves, safety glasses, and non-conductive footwear when working near electrical systems or equipment.
06
Establish clear communication: Establish effective communication channels to ensure that workers can report electrical safety concerns or incidents promptly. Encourage open communication between workers and supervisors to address any hazards or queries.
07
Follow local regulations and codes: Familiarize yourself with local electrical safety regulations and codes relevant to construction projects. Ensure compliance with these regulations to mitigate risks and maintain a safe working environment.
